Description
This Second Book of Bassoon Solos is designed for the student in the second or third year of learning. The pieces cover a wide variety of styles and aim to explore the expressive qualities of the instrument. Many of the pieces feature brief explanatory notes.

About the Arranger: Lyndon Hilling

Lyndon Hilling is a British bassoonist and educator whose work as an arranger reflects decades of experience understanding how young players develop on their instruments. His collections prioritize musical variety alongside technical growth, creating repertoire that keeps students engaged while building genuine artistry.

How to get the most out of it

  • Study the explanatory notes before touching the piece. They're there for a reason and often unlock the character you're searching for.
  • Balance the piano part carefully; these aren't accompanied solos where the bassoon drowns everything else out. Listen for moments where the piano leads.
  • Choose one piece to live with for several weeks rather than rushing through the collection. Depth of interpretation matters more at this level than covering ground.
